Sizing Your System Sizing your solar system is vital for increasing energy manufacturing and financial savings. Properly identifying your requirements can lead to much better financial investment returns and lower costs.
  • Assess your electricity use. Review your past utility costs to find average regular monthly consumption in kilowatt-hours (kWh). This number assists you recognize your energy needs.
  • Evaluate available roof area. Measure the area on your roofing where you can install solar panels without obstructions, such as trees or chimneys. Restricting shielding will increase solar power production.
  • Understand Nova Scotia's solar capacity. The province ranks nine in Canada for solar power production possibility, with some locations getting adequate sunlight throughout the year.
  • Calculate necessary panel ability. Split your total yearly kWh usage by the expected yearly output per panel, factoring in regional problems and panel efficiency ratings.
  • Look into system dimension suggestions. Normally, a common domestic system ranges from 4 kW to 10 kW, depending upon house power needs and budget plan considerations.
  • Consider elements that affect system prices. Installation area, equipment quality, and work expenditures can influence both initial financial investment and long-term savings.
  • Explore financing choices to figure out price. Programs like government tax credit reports and Nova Scotia Power rewards can decrease ahead of time costs dramatically; think about these when assessing overall expenses.
  • Be familiar with web metering plans in Nova Scotia. Net metering allows you to financial institution excess solar production at full retail value for approximately 12 months; this attribute boosts general savings and return on investment.
  • Plan for future energy needs in addition to present ones. If you expect increased electrical power usage due to way of living adjustments or brand-new appliances, factor that into your calculations currently as opposed to later.

The Solar Installation Process The solar installment process in Nova Scotia entails several crucial steps. Understanding each step prepares you for your transition to solar power.
  • Assess Your Power Demands: Start by examining your existing power usage. Gather electricity bills to locate your complete use in kilowatt-hours (kWh). This info helps determine the system size required for optimum performance.
  • Choose a Solar Installer: Research study and pick a reputable solar setup firm. Confirm their experience, certifications, and customer comments. A certified contractor makes certain correct installation and access to incentives.
  • Site Assessment: Set up a website evaluation with your selected installer. The professional will examine your roof covering's problem, alignment, and shielding aspects. This assessment is essential for maximising solar power production.
  • System Layout: Your installer will certainly develop a tailor-maked photovoltaic system based on the website examination results and power needs. They think about regional regulations, available room, and aesthetic preferences throughout this phase.
  • Obtain Allows: Your installer will certainly manage the essential licenses required by neighborhood authorities and Nova Scotia Power. This step ensures compliance with building ordinance and safety and security standards.
  • Installation Day: On the set up setup day, service technicians show up to set up your solar panels, inverter, and electric links. The procedure normally takes one to 3 days depending upon system size.
  • Connection to Grid: After setup, the system connects to the electrical grid with web metering contracts with Nova Scotia Power. This link allows you to receive credit scores for excess energy produced.
  • System Evaluation: A rep from Nova Scotia Power will inspect the installed system before approving approval to run it fully. They guarantee that whatever satisfies regulative requirements.
  • Monitor Efficiency: After getting consent to operate, check your planetary system's efficiency using online devices supplied by your installer or software program apps customized for this purpose.
  • Enjoy Benefits: With effective installation full, you can start delighting in long-term cost savings on electrical power prices while contributing to renewable energy goals in Nova Scotia.

Web Metering in Nova Scotia Web metering enables house owners in Nova Scotia to handle their solar power production properly. This program permits you to bank any excess solar electricity generated at a 1:1 retail value for up to twelve month. You can draw from this financial institution anytime your usage surpasses your production, developing significant power savings. The benefits of net metering include decreased dependancy on the grid and lower electrical power costs. Photovoltaic panel owners typically see a common payback duration for installations ranging from 10 to 12 years. Hereafter period, they take pleasure in nearly 13 to 18 years of low and even no energy costs, making renewable energy an eye-catching investment in Nova Scotia.
